Positive ShockPlay
Used when something is surprisingly positive or impressive, not frightening. SlideHis magic show left the audience in amazement.

Physical ResponsePlay
People might visibly react, like with a gasp or wide eyes, when feeling amazement. SlideHe dropped his book in amazement upon hearing the news.

Momentary StatePlay
Amazement is a momentary reaction, not a lasting emotion. SlideShe was in amazement at the fireworks but soon calmed down.
